Ingredients for Sloppy Joe Casserole

Gathering the right ingredients is key to making a delicious Sloppy Joe Casserole.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Ground beef: The star of the dish, providing a hearty base. You can substitute with ground turkey or chicken for a lighter option.
  • Sloppy Joe sauce: This adds that classic, tangy flavor. You can use store-bought or make your own for a personal touch.
  • Shredded cheddar cheese: A must for that gooey, melty topping. Feel free to experiment with other cheeses like Monterey Jack or pepper jack for a kick.
  • Frozen mixed vegetables: These add color and nutrition. You can swap them for fresh veggies like corn or peas if you prefer.
  • Crescent roll dough: This creates a flaky crust. If you’re feeling adventurous, try puff pastry for a different texture.
  • Chopped onion: Adds sweetness and depth. You can use shallots or green onions as alternatives.
  • Chopped bell pepper: Provides crunch and flavor. Any color works, but red or yellow are sweeter.
  • Salt and pepper: Essential for seasoning. Adjust to your taste, and consider adding garlic powder for extra flavor.

How to Make Sloppy Joe Casserole

Now that you have all your ingredients ready, let’s dive into making this delightful Sloppy Joe Casserole! Follow these simple steps, and you’ll have a delicious meal on the table in no time.

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

First things first, pre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Preheating is crucial because it ensures even cooking. You want that casserole to bake perfectly, with a golden crust and warm filling.

Step 2: Brown the Ground Beef

In a large skillet, brown the ground beef over medium heat. Use a wooden spoon to break it apart as it cooks. This helps it brown evenly. Once it’s no longer pink, drain the excess fat. Nobody wants a greasy casserole!

Step 3: Sauté the Vegetables

Next, add the chopped onion and bell pepper to the skillet. Sauté them until they’re softened, about 3-4 minutes. This step adds a lovely sweetness and depth to your Sloppy Joe Casserole. The aroma will make your kitchen feel like home!

Step 4: Combine with Sloppy Joe Sauce

Now, stir in the Sloppy Joe sauce and frozen mixed vegetables. Cook everything together for an additional 5 minutes. This allows the flavors to meld beautifully. You’ll see the mixture bubbling, and that’s when you know it’s ready!

Step 5: Assemble the Casserole

Spread the beef mixture evenly in a greased casserole dish. Make sure it’s well-distributed so every bite is packed with flavor. This is where the magic begins, as you layer the goodness!

Step 6: Add Crescent Roll Dough

Unroll the crescent roll dough and place it over the beef mixture. Gently seal the edges to create a cozy blanket for your casserole. This flaky crust is what makes this dish so comforting and delicious!

Step 7: Top with Cheese

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ese generously on top. This will melt into a gooey, cheesy layer that everyone will love. Who can resist that melty goodness? It’s the cherry on top of this savory dish!

Step 8: Bake the Casserole

Finally, bake your casserole in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es. Keep an eye on it! You want the dough to be golden brown and the filling to be bubbling. Once it’s done, let it cool for a few minutes before serving. This will help everything set nicely.

FAQs about Sloppy Joe Casserole

Can I make Sloppy Joe Casserole 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the casserole in advance and store it in the refrigerator. Just assemble it without baking, cover it tightly, and pop it in the fridge. When you’re ready to enjoy it, bake it straight from the fridge, adding a few extra minutes to the cooking time.

What can I substitute for ground beef?

If you’re looking for a lighter option, ground turkey or chicken works beautifully in this Sloppy Joe Casserole. For a vegetarian twist, try using lentils or black beans. They’ll soak up all the delicious flavors!

How do I store leftovers?

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. Just reheat in the microwave or oven until warmed through. It’s just as tasty the next day!

Can I freeze Sloppy Joe Casserole?

Yes, you can freeze this casserole! Just make sure it’s completely cooled before wrapping it tightly in plastic wrap and aluminum foil. It can be frozen for up to three months. Thaw it in the fridge overnight before baking.

What sides pair well with Sloppy Joe Casserole?

This casserole is versatile! Pair it with a fresh garden salad, garlic bread, or even coleslaw for a delightful contrast. Each side adds a unique touch to your meal!

Description

Sloppy Joe Casserole is a hearty and flavorful dish that combines the classic taste of Sloppy Joes with the comforting texture of a casserole, making it a perfect family me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b ground beef
  • 1 can (15 oz) Sloppy Joe sauce
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up frozen mixed vegetables
  • 1 package (8 oz) refrigerated crescent roll dough
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1/2 cup chopped bell pepper
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a large skillet, brown the ground beef over medium heat. Drain excess fat.
  3. Add chopped onion and bell pepper to the skillet and cook until softened.
  4. Stir in the Sloppy Joe sauce and frozen mixed vegetables. Cook for an additional 5 minutes.
  5. Spread the beef mixture evenly in a greased casserole dish.
  6. Unroll the crescent roll dough and place it over the beef mixture, sealing the edges.
  7.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ese on top.
  8.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until the dough is golden brown.
  9.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.

Notes

  • Feel free to add your favorite vegetables to the beef mixture.
  • This dish can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ator before baking.
  •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
